A traffic collision involving two vehicles occurred today on Angeles Forest Highway near mile marker 12.64 in Singing Springs, CA. The incident involved a black Maserati and a Toyota Quest van, with reports indicating that the Maserati was racing with a Porsche prior to the crash.
Emergency services were alerted at 11:03 AM, and responders quickly arrived on the scene. The collision blocked both northbound and southbound lanes, causing significant traffic disruptions. A tow truck was requested to assist with the vehicles involved, with an estimated arrival time of approximately 35 minutes.
By 12:17 PM, all lanes were reopened, allowing traffic to resume its normal flow. While the status of any injuries remains unknown, the prompt response from emergency services helped to clear the scene efficiently.
